WebThe economics of drying timber was assessed for a green-house type solar kiln along with the conventional drying techniques. Both the operating and capital costs of the solar kiln were much lower than those of the steam kiln. Compared to air drying the solar drying was cheaper and cost less than one-half of the steam kilning. The pay back period was about … WebDuffie, N. A. and Close, D. Different sawing patterns have an effect on the noughts and crosses game on googleWebThe result was air-dried or air-seasoned lumber, which in Missouri typically has a moisture content (MC) between 12 and 14 percent. Moisture content is defined as: MC percent = (Green weight − overdry weight)/Overdry weight × 100. The green or wet weight is the as-is weight.
